In one of the prospect threads I asked why Kylington was dropping like a stone in the draft rankings from Top Euro skater to 18th overall and then to be available with the 60th pick and then not being invited to the Swedish U20 WJC summer camp.

Was it the demotion from the big league to the 2nd league? The combine? Was he out of shape, not being able to do a pull up?

Nobody even would guess an answer.

WJC U18 Kylington

april 16 preliminary Sweden 3 Slovalia 1 0 pts 1 sog -1
april 18 Preliminary Sweden 7 Germany 1 2 assist 1 sog +1
april 19 Preliminary USA 6 Sweden 4 0 pts 0 SOG -3
april 20 Preliminary RUS 7 Sweden 4 SOG 0 pts -3
april 22 Quarter Final Canada 5 Sweden 3 0 pts 3 SoG -1

Against the 4 games of teams that qualified for the final 8

0 pts 4 SOG and team worst -8

Outside of various players on 0-4 Germany he had the tourney worst -7 to go with his 2 assists in the 7-1 drubbing of Germany.

so on the larger ice service in Switzerland in the last games he played basically with and against the players being drafted 2 months later he was a disaster. It would have been a huge leap for Sweden to invite him to the U20 camp.

Rasmus Andersson was playing with the Barrie Colts in the OHL playoffs eliminated April 18.


Kind of funny that there was no mention of his disappointing play in the WJC U18 tourney. That was the same Tourney that in 2013 Morgan Klimchuk likely moved up into the first round with a strong tourney.
